- [ ] Step 7: Archive cold storage buckets (Glacierline tier). Confirm both ceremony witnesses are present, verify bucket manifests match the Oxbow ledger, then seal the archive key shares. Plugin authors may observe but not handle shares. Once sealed, the archive index itself is encrypted and can only be reopened with the passphrase below.

vault phrase of badup-hahig = tamael-aldael-kelmir-istael-fenok-istwyn-tamius-jorath-oliion

MEMO — Budget Request for the Board

Short version: the Oakenfield product team needs an additional tranche this half to finish the Skylark tooling upgrade. We underestimated fabrication costs, not scope. Without it, launch slips past the trade season and we lose our window. Renna has the detailed breakdown ready on request. The reasoning rests on something we've kept off the general agenda.

internal memo for yahag-hahig: Belwynix Group plans to lower the Silir list price by 62 percent in May.

## Rollout — Bloomfront Cache Layer

Bloomfront sits in front of the Kestrel KV store and short-circuits misses. On release: rebuild the filter from the latest snapshot, verify false-positive rate under 1%, then swap via `bfctl promote`. Never promote with a stale snapshot — miss storms will hammer Kestrel. The promote step signs the filter manifest before upload, so set up the deploy key below first.

release key, hadug-kawef: bky13_mPGeFZeR1GZ1G